Values
Core principles or standards of behavior that are considered important by an individual or group in terms of guiding their actions and judgments.
Artifacts
Tangible or visible elements in an organization's culture, such as its language, symbols, stories, rituals, and physical setup, which serve as expressions of its values and norms.
Identifiable Elements
Refers to components within a system or environment that can be distinctly recognized and differentiated from one another.
Culture
A set of shared values, beliefs, customs, practices, and social behavior of a particular nation or people.
